Palaeomagnetism and palaeogeography of Mongolia from the Carboniferous to the Cretaceous—final report (Dataset)

Petr Pruner

Magnetics Information Consortium (MagIC)

(2006)

Paleomagnetic, rock magnetic, or geomagnetic data found in the MagIC data repository from a paper titled: Palaeomagnetism and palaeogeography of Mongolia from the Carboniferous to the Cretaceous—final report
